I re-threaded a mines for NPT and stuck a GM style 3 pin pressure sensor in there. Once you have actual pressures the oil light is useless, wire it so it doesn't throw a light and relay on the actual pressures.

No matter what those type of senders shouldn't be used in that location due to size of the unit, plenty of units that use the type of sensor I used.
